The Itinerary and Highlights

The core of this tour is the Mutianyu Great Wall, often considered the most popular and picturesque section near Beijing, thanks to its well-preserved watchtowers and scenic surroundings. The entrance fee is included, so no surprises at the gate. Once there, your driver will point out the best vantage points and help you get the perfect shot—be it on top of the wall or at the famous watchtowers.

What many travelers appreciate is the free time to explore on your own. This means you can wander at your own pace, soak in the views, or snap photos without feeling rushed. The tour offers optional activities like the cable car or toboggan ride (payable in cash, CNY 140 for round trip), which are highly recommended for a fun ascent or descent, especially for those less keen on walking uphill.

Duration and Timing

While the tour is officially 5-6 hours, actual times can vary based on your start time and how long you wish to spend at the Wall. Most reviews mention a total trip duration of around 7 hours, which accounts for pickup, travel, exploration, and drop-off back at your hotel or airport.

Since the Great Wall operates from 7:30 am to 5 pm, the earliest pickup is around 6 am, and the latest is 1:30 pm. This flexibility makes it feasible even during a tight layover or short city visit. Reviewers also note that, with careful planning, you can comfortably fit this adventure into a 10-hour window, including airport transfers.
